National Sports Day Commemorated at Pioneer Public School

Balrampur city's English medium institution, Pioneer Public School and College, vibrantly celebrated the birth anniversary of the legendary hockey player Major Dhyan Chand as National Sports Day on Friday. The occasion was marked with enthusiasm and a series of commemorative activities.

The event commenced with the School's Managing Director Dr. M.P. Tiwari, Manager Er. Akash Tiwari, Director Prakriti Tiwari, and Vice-Principal Shikha Pandey paying floral tribute and lighting a lamp before a portrait of Major Dhyan Chand. Following this, the Managing Director addressed the students, elaborating on Major Dhyan Chand's life and his significant contributions to the world of sports.

He informed the students that Major Dhyan Chand was born on August 29, 1905, in Allahabad, and his birthday is declared as India's National Sports Day. It is on this day that players who have excelled in sports are honored with national awards. The Indian Olympic Association had also declared him 'Player of the Century'. His exceptional command of hockey and understanding of the game's nuances earned him the title 'The Wizard of Hockey'.

The Managing Director also recalled that the Prime Minister of India, Shri Narendra Modi, had previously renamed the Rajiv Gandhi Khel Ratna Award to the 'Major Dhyan Chand Khel Ratna Award' in his honor. The school also saw the inauguration of hockey activities and a competition, led by the Managing Director and overseen by team coach Amit Rana, on the school grounds. An exciting hockey match was played between two school teams, showcasing the students' talent.

Diverse Sports, Speeches, and Cultural Programs

In addition to the hockey tournament, the school organized various other sports competitions, speech events, and cultural presentations to mark National Sports Day. The sports activities included a zig-zag race for the pre-primary section and a running race for the primary section, both of which saw enthusiastic participation from students.

In the speech competition, Shivansh Het, Prathmesh Tiwari, Pragya Pandey, Mohini Jaiswal, and Kartik Srivastava shared their thoughts on Major Dhyan Chand and the spirit of sportsmanship. A captivating dance performance based on the song 'Chak De India' was presented by Aradhya, Simr, Shreyasi, Subhiksha, and Himanshi, which enthralled the audience.
